Phosphoric acid ionizes in three steps with their ionization constant values
\(Ka_1\), \(Ka_2\), and \(Ka_3\), respectively,while K is the overall ionization constant.
Which of the following statements are true?
A. \(\text{log} K\) = \(\text{log} Ka_1\) + \(\text{log}Ka_2\) +\(\text{log}Ka_3\)
B. \(H_3PO_4\) is a stronger acid than \(H_2PO_4^-\) and \(HPO_4^{2-}\).
ะก. \(Ka_1\) > \(Ka_2\) > \(Ka_3\).
D. \(\displaystyle Ka_1\,= \,\frac{Ka_3\,+\,Ka_2}{2}\).
Choose the correct answer from the options given below:
